A worm gearbox, also known as a worm gear reducer, is a type of gear system that consists of a worm (a screw-like component) and a worm gear (a toothed wheel). The worm engages with the worm gear to create movement that is typically perpendicular to the worm. This type of gearbox is especially prevalent in applications requiring slow rotation speeds and high torque.
Worm gearboxes play a pivotal role in industrial and mechanical applications. They are capable of reducing rotational speed or allowing higher torque to be transmitted. This makes them suitable for numerous applications, including conveyor systems, packaging equipment, and in the context of our topic, vehicle emission testing equipment.
The worm gear reducer operates based on the meshing relationship between the worm and the worm gear. The worm, which is connected to the input shaft powered by the motor, rotates and engages with the teeth on the worm gear. This interaction results in the worm gear, and subsequently the output shaft, turning. Due to the angle and direction of the worm’s thread, the worm gear cannot drive the worm, which results in a self-locking effect. This is especially beneficial in applications where safety is paramount.
The worm, akin to a screw, is the driving component of the gearbox. Its rotation is what drives the worm gear and creates output motion.
The worm gear is like a standard gear but has concave teeth to accommodate the worm. It’s the component that delivers the output motion.
The input shaft is connected to the worm and is where the input motion and power come from. The output shaft is connected to the worm gear and delivers the final output motion.
